From 89064878df0afccff672eefe45f24dab03b0ea9c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Th=C3=A9ophile=20Bastian?= Date: Thu, 28 Jun 2018 11:53:38 +0200 Subject: [PATCH] Add libcxxfileno libsrk31cxx --- .gitignore | 3 +++ libcxxfileno/.gitignore | 1 + libcxxfileno/PKGBUILD | 33 +++++++++++++++++++++++++++++++++ libsrk31cxx/.gitignore | 1 + libsrk31cxx/PKGBUILD | 33 +++++++++++++++++++++++++++++++++ 5 files changed, 71 insertions(+) create mode 100644 .gitignore create mode 100644 libcxxfileno/.gitignore create mode 100644 libcxxfileno/PKGBUILD create mode 100644 libsrk31cxx/.gitignore create mode 100644 libsrk31cxx/PKGBUILD di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..6c5134b --- /dev/null +++ b/.gitignore @@ -0,0 +1,3 @@ +pkg +src +*.tar.xz diff --git a/libcxxfileno/.gitignore b/libcxxfileno/.gitignore new file mode 100644 index 0000000..82741fc --- /dev/null +++ b/libcxxfileno/.gitignore @@ -0,0 +1 @@ +libcxxfileno diff --git a/libcxxfileno/PKGBUILD b/libcxxfileno/PKGBUILD new file mode 100644 index 0000000..e7547da --- /dev/null +++ b/libcxxfileno/PKGBUILD @@ -0,0 +1,33 @@ +# Maintainer: Théophile Bastian +pkgname=libcxxfileno-git +_pkgname="${pkgname%-git}" +pkgver=r17.bb4b85e +pkgrel=1 +provides=($_pkgname) +conflicts=($_pkgname) +pkgdesc="Libcxxfileno by Stephen R. Kell" +arch=('x86_64') +url="https://github.com/stephenrkell/libcxxfileno" +license=('?') +depends=() +makedepends=('git' 'make' 'autoconf') +install= +source=("git+https://github.com/stephenrkell/libcxxfileno") +md5sums=('SKIP') + +pkgver() { + cd "$srcdir/${_pkgname}" + print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" +} + +build() { + cd "$srcdir/${_pkgname}" + autoreconf -i + ./configure --prefix=/usr + make -j +} + +package() { + cd "$srcdir/${_pkgname}" + make DESTDIR="$pkgdir/" install +} diff --git a/libsrk31cxx/.gitignore b/libsrk31cxx/.gitignore new file mode 100644 index 0000000..798658a --- /dev/null +++ b/libsrk31cxx/.gitignore @@ -0,0 +1 @@ +libsrk31cxx diff --git a/libsrk31cxx/PKGBUILD b/libsrk31cxx/PKGBUILD new file mode 100644 index 0000000..1223d71 --- /dev/null +++ b/libsrk31cxx/PKGBUILD @@ -0,0 +1,33 @@ +# Maintainer: Théophile Bastian +pkgname=libsrk31cxx-git +_pkgname="${pkgname%-git}" +pkgver=r55.85147ba +pkgrel=1 +provides=($_pkgname) +conflicts=($_pkgname) +pkgdesc="libsrk31cxx-git by Stephen R. Kell" +arch=('x86_64') +url="https://github.com/stephenrkell/libsrk31cxx" +license=('?') +depends=() +makedepends=('git' 'make' 'autoconf') +install= +source=("git+https://github.com/stephenrkell/libsrk31cxx") +md5sums=('SKIP') + +pkgver() { + cd "$srcdir/${_pkgname}" + print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" +} + +build() { + cd "$srcdir/${_pkgname}" + autoreconf -i + ./configure --prefix=/usr + make -j +} + +package() { + cd "$srcdir/${_pkgname}" + make DESTDIR="$pkgdir/" install +}